Unlocking the Potential of NFTs: How Non-Fungible Tokens are Changing the Game

Nft cryptocurrency

In recent years, the world of digital art and collectibles has been revolutionized by the emergence of Non-Fungible Tokens (NFTs). These unique digital assets are changing the way we perceive ownership and authenticity in the digital realm.

One of the key aspects of NFTs is their ability to unlock the potential of digital artists and creators. By tokenizing their work, artists can now easily prove ownership and authenticity, as each NFT is recorded on a blockchain, ensuring transparency and security. This has opened up new avenues for artists to monetize their work and reach a global audience like never before.

Famous artists like Beeple have made headlines for selling their NFT artworks for millions of dollars, bringing mainstream attention to the world of NFTs. In addition, well-known brands like NBA Top Shot have capitalized on the trend by creating digital collectibles that have become highly sought after by fans and collectors alike.

As NFTs continue to gain popularity, they are also being used in innovative ways beyond the art world. From virtual real estate to in-game assets, NFTs are changing the way we think about ownership in the digital space.

From Digital Art to Real Estate: How NFTs are Reshaping Traditional Markets

The rise of NFTs, or non-fungible tokens, is revolutionizing traditional markets across various industries. What started as a trend in the world of digital art has now expanded into sectors like real estate, transforming the way assets are bought and sold.

NFTs allow for the unique tokenization of assets, creating a digital certificate of ownership that is stored on a blockchain. This technology has enabled artists to monetize their work in ways previously unimaginable, with some pieces selling for millions of dollars. However, the impact of NFTs goes beyond the art world, as they are now being utilized in real estate transactions.

By tokenizing real estate assets, NFTs are providing a new level of liquidity and accessibility to the market. Investors can now buy fractional ownership of properties through NFTs, opening up opportunities for smaller investors to participate in the real estate market. Additionally, NFTs can streamline the purchasing process, reducing the need for intermediaries and paperwork.

This article is important for understanding how NFTs are reshaping traditional markets, offering new possibilities for both artists and investors.
